Knowledge Summary

This Maven is an acknowledged expert on the toy and video game space and provides business intelligence on both industries for the US market as well as international. He bases his predictions and insights on four source levels - the first is a retailer panel of ten stores, the second national buyers at the key retailers both in the US and international, the third is Chinese toy manufacturers who produce for large U.S. and European toy companies , and the fourth peripheral sources such as ad agencies, PR agencies, Head Hunters and componentry suppliers.

He authors articles published by the Toy Directory, the leading U.S. toy and video game publication. He is also often quoted as expert by the Wall Street Journal, Los Angeles Times, Forbes, NY Times, Globe and Mail and other national newspapers. He has also appeared at the Business News Network of Canada as an expert on video games and toys.
